Este estudo objetivou identificar a prevalência dos diferentes tipos de aleitamento e sua relação com variáveis maternas no município de Conchas-SP, totalmente coberto pelo PSF. Foram obtidas informações sobre a alimentação atual das crianças menores de um ano que compareceram à primeira etapa da Campanha de Multivacinação de 2003. As associações foram submetidas ao teste do qui-quadrado, adotando-se 5% como nível de significância estatística. As prevalências do Aleitamento Materno Exclusivo (AME) e do Aleitamento Materno Predominante (AMP), em menores de 4 meses de vida, foram 25,4 e 44,4%, respectivamente, e 66,7% do total de crianças menores de um ano ainda eram amamentadas. A prevalência do AME em menores de 6 meses foi heterogênea, variando de 7,4 a 41,2%, conforme a equipe do PSF de procedência das crianças. Ter passado por dificuldades no início do aleitamento associou-se a menores prevalências de AME e Aleitamento Materno (AM). Esses resultados evidenciam situação distante da recomendada pela Organização Mundial de Saúde e aquela para a qual há evidências de máximo efeito protetor à saúde infantil, reafirmam a necessidade de apoio às mães no período puerperal precoce e demonstram a importância de diagnósticos desagregados por regiões para o planejamento de ações de promoção ao AM.

Both Epstein-Barr virus (EBV) types A and B are found in endemic Burkitt's lymphoma (BL) occurring in equatorial Africa. We studied 17 cases of Brazilian BL previously demonstrated to be EBV-positive to determine the EBV type as well as the presence of a characteristic 30 bp deletion within the 3' end of the latent membrane protein-1 (LMP-1) gene that may be important to the pathogenesis of several EBV-associated neoplasms. All case in which the age was known were children. We found type A EBV in 13 of 14 (93%) evaluable cases, and type B in one case. The LMP-1 deletion was found in 12 of 15 (80%) evaluable cases, including the one case of type B EBV, and a similar high prevalence (59%) of the deletion was detected in EBV-positive normal and reactive lymphoid tissues from individuals from the same geographic region. The high proportion of cases associated with type A EBV suggests that immunodeficiency is not an important factor in the pathogenesis of Brazilian BL, in contrast to endemic African BL. The presence of the LMP-1 deletion in a high prevalence in the normal population in this region is unexplained.

This paper presents a methodology for the placement and sizing evaluation of distributed generation (DG) in electric power systems. The candidate locations for DG placement are identified on the bases of Locational Marginal Prices (LMP's) obtained from an optimal power flow solution. The problem is formulated for two different objectives: social welfare maximization and profit maximization. For each DG unit an optimal placement is identified for each of the objectives.

Objective. The aim of this study was to verify the possibility of lactate minimum (LM) determination during a walking test and the validity of such LM protocol on predicting the maximal lactate steady-state (MLSS) intensity. Design. Eleven healthy subjects (24.2 ± 4.5 yr; 74.3 ± 7.7 kg; 176.9 ± 4.1 cm) performed LM tests on a treadmill, consisting of walking at 5.5 km h -1 and with 20-22% of inclination until voluntary exhaustion to induce metabolic acidosis. After 7 minutes of recovery the participants performed an incremental test starting at 7% incline with increments of 2% at each 3 minutes until exhaustion. A polynomial modeling approach (LMp) and a visual inspection (LMv) were used to identify the LM as the exercise intensity associated to the lowest [bLac] during the test. Participants also underwent to 24 constant intensity tests of 30 minutes to determine the MLSS intensity. Results. There were no differences among LMv (12.6 ± 1.7 %), LMp (13.1 ± 1.5 %), and MLSS (13.6 ± 2.1 %) and the Bland and Altman plots evidenced acceptable agreement between them. Conclusion. It was possible to identify the LM during walking tests with intensity imposed by treadmill inclination, and it seemed to be valid on identifying the exercise intensity associated to the MLSS.
